加入收藏 | 设为首页 | 会员中心 | 我要投稿 开发网_新乡站长网 (https://www.0373zz.com/)- 决策智能、语音技术、AI应用、CDN、开发!
当前位置: 首页 > 百科 > 正文

移动H5速建:UI测试工程师视角的高效框架与设计技巧

发布时间:2026-06-27 15:51:32 所属栏目:百科 来源:DaWei
导读:  在移动H5快速开发的浪潮中,UI测试工程师的角色正从被动验证转向主动赋能。面对频繁迭代的页面需求与多端兼容的复杂环境,如何构建一个高效、可复用的测试框架,成为提升交付质量的关键。从工程师视角出发,核心

  在移动H5快速开发的浪潮中,UI测试工程师的角色正从被动验证转向主动赋能。面对频繁迭代的页面需求与多端兼容的复杂环境,如何构建一个高效、可复用的测试框架,成为提升交付质量的关键。从工程师视角出发,核心在于将测试流程标准化、自动化,并融入设计阶段的前瞻性考量。


  高效框架的起点是组件化思维。将常见交互元素如按钮、表单、弹窗等抽象为独立模块,不仅减少重复代码,更便于测试脚本的统一维护。每个组件应具备明确的标识属性(如data-test-id),确保测试工具能精准定位,避免因结构变化导致测试失效。同时,通过约定命名规范,使团队成员在协作中无需额外沟通即可理解组件用途。


AI生成3D模型,仅供参考

  在设计环节引入“可测性”原则至关重要。设计师若能在原型阶段预留测试锚点,例如为关键路径添加唯一标识或状态标签,将极大降低后期测试的调试成本。测试工程师应提前介入设计评审,提出合理建议:如避免使用动态生成的类名,或限制嵌套层级过深的结构。这些微小调整,能在后续自动化脚本编写中节省大量时间。


  框架的灵活性依赖于配置驱动。通过分离业务逻辑与测试逻辑,采用JSON或YAML格式定义页面元素映射关系,使测试脚本不再硬编码路径。当页面结构调整时,仅需更新配置文件,无需重写脚本。这种解耦方式特别适用于多版本并行测试的场景,大幅提升跨环境测试效率。


  数据模拟是提升测试覆盖率的重要手段。利用Mock服务拦截真实接口请求,返回预设响应数据,可覆盖异常状态、空数据、超时等多种边界情况。结合本地存储模拟,实现登录态保持、缓存刷新等操作的可控测试。这不仅缩短等待时间,也避免了对真实后端的依赖,让测试更稳定、更快速。


  持续集成(CI)是框架落地的保障。将测试脚本接入CI流水线,每次代码提交自动触发前端构建与测试执行。通过可视化报告快速定位失败用例,配合截图与日志记录,实现问题闭环追踪。对于高频变更的页面,甚至可设置实时监控,一旦出现渲染异常立即告警。


  框架的生命力在于迭代优化。定期收集测试工程师反馈,分析失败案例的共性,持续改进组件封装、增强容错机制。鼓励团队共享通用测试模块,形成内部知识库。当框架逐渐沉淀为“即插即用”的标准工具集,整个研发流程的效率将实现质的飞跃。


  真正的高效,不在于工具多强大,而在于是否建立起一套以人为核心、可持续演进的协作体系。当测试不再是交付的终点,而是推动设计与开发共同进化的引擎,移动H5的快速构建才能真正实现质量与速度的双赢。

(编辑:开发网_新乡站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章